"portaguidone" meaning in Italian

See portaguidone in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Noun

Forms: portaguidoni [plural]
Etymology: Verb-object compound, composed of porta (“to carry”) + guidone (“guidon, pennant”).   1. (military) guidon (soldier who carries a banner) Tags: masculine
